What is included in Kaspersky Internet Security?

Real-Time Protection – Blocks malware, ransomware and phishing as they appear.
Two-Way Firewall – Filters network traffic and stops intrusion attempts.
Safe Money – Opens banking sites in a protected browser window.
Webcam Protection – Stops unauthorized apps from accessing your camera.
Private Browsing – Blocks trackers that follow you across websites.
Important – Unlimited VPN, full password manager and parental controls are not included; the bundled VPN is capped at 300 MB per day.

What are the main benefits of Kaspersky Internet Security?

Kaspersky Internet Security is a mid-range protection suite for Windows, macOS, Android and iOS that combines a top-rated malware engine with a firewall and secure-payment tools. It targets everyday threats during browsing, online banking and email without slowing the device down.

Proven Detection – Scores 100% in AV-Test real-world malware tests.
Banking Defense – Safe Money guards card data with an on-screen keyboard.
Low System Load – Light background impact, even during full scans.
Cross-Platform Cover – One license protects PC, Mac and mobile.
Anti-Phishing – Flags fake login and payment pages before entry.
Network Attack Blocker – Detects port scans and exploit attempts early.

What does Kaspersky Internet Security do?

It protects a device against viruses, ransomware, phishing and network attacks using Kaspersky's real-time scanning engine, which reached 100% protection with no false positives in independent AV-Test and SE Labs trials. The same engine runs across Kaspersky Free, Internet Security and the company's business tools, but here it is paired with a two-way firewall and Safe Money. In practice, when you open a banking site, Safe Money launches it in an isolated browser window and offers an on-screen keyboard so keyloggers cannot capture card details. This makes it stronger than the built-in Windows Defender for users who shop and bank online regularly.

Does Kaspersky Internet Security include a VPN, and what is the data limit?

It includes the Kaspersky VPN (Secure Connection), but the bundled version is limited to 300 MB of encrypted traffic per day. That allowance is enough to secure a short banking session or login on public Wi-Fi, but it runs out quickly during streaming, large downloads or a full working day on a hotspot. Unlimited VPN data is only available in the Kaspersky Plus and Premium plans, not in this edition. If daily private browsing matters to you, treat the included VPN as an occasional safety tool rather than an always-on connection.

Does it include parental controls or a password manager?

Parental controls (Safe Kids) and the password manager are not built into this edition as full versions; they install as separate companion apps with limited functionality. The bundled password tool can store and autofill credentials but lacks the full vault, data-leak checking and unlimited capacity of the standalone Premium Password Manager. Likewise, the free Safe Kids component covers basic content filtering and screen-time limits, but advanced family management is reserved for the Kaspersky Premium plan. If a household needs proper child-safety rules per device or a complete password vault, that is a reason to look at a higher tier rather than this product.

How does Kaspersky Internet Security compare to the current Standard, Plus and Premium plans?

Kaspersky replaced its classic Internet Security and Total Security lineup with three plans — Standard, Plus and Premium — that all share the same protection engine. Internet Security sits closest to the mid-range in capability: it covers core protection and Safe Money but limits the VPN and ships parental controls and the password manager only as restricted add-ons. Plus adds an unlimited VPN and the full password manager, while Premium layers on identity protection, full parental controls and priority support. The table below shows where the paid tiers differ so you can decide whether the extra privacy and family tools are worth a higher plan.

What should users check before choosing Kaspersky Internet Security?

Confirm that you do not need an always-on VPN, full parental controls or identity-theft monitoring, because those are missing or capped in this edition. The product is a strong fit if your priority is malware defense plus protected online banking on Windows or Mac, where the Safe Money browser and 100%-rated engine do the heavy lifting. Buyers comparing brands should note that Kaspersky here lacks dark-web monitoring, which Norton 360 includes at a similar level. If you mainly want clean, low-impact core protection and secure payments, this edition covers it; if you want bundled privacy and family tools, the Plus or Premium plan is the better target.

Frequently asked questions about Kaspersky Internet Security

Can Kaspersky Internet Security protect Mac, Android and iOS devices?

Yes, one license covers Windows, macOS, Android and iOS, so you can protect a mixed household from a single product. Note that protection depth varies by platform: the firewall and Safe Money are strongest on Windows, while some extras run as limited companion apps on Mac and mobile. There is no free Kaspersky antivirus for macOS, so a paid plan is required to cover a MacBook.

Is Kaspersky Internet Security still sold or has it been replaced?

Kaspersky has consolidated its consumer range into Standard, Plus and Premium plans, which now use the same protection engine as Internet Security. The Internet Security edition is still available through software-key shops and remains fully functional for malware protection and secure payments. If you want unlimited VPN or full identity tools out of the box, the Plus or Premium plan is the current equivalent path.

System requirements

Operating Systems Windows 11: Home / Pro / Enterprise
Windows 10: Home / Pro / Enterprise
Windows 8.1: Pro / Enterprise 
Windows 8: Pro / Enterprise
Windows 7: Starter / Home Basic / Home Premium / Professional / Ultimate / SP1 
Processor 1 GHz or faster, x86 or x64 with SSE2 instruction set support
Memory RAM 2 GB minimum
Hard Disk 1500 MB free disk space
Display Standard display compatible with the respective operating system
Protection Modules Real time protection components including File Anti Virus, Web Anti Virus, Mail Anti Virus, and IM Anti Virus
Firewall and Network Monitor
System Watcher behavior monitoring
Network Attack Blocker
Anti Phishing and Anti Spam
Webcam Protection
Application Control
Note Windows 7 requires Service Pack 1.
For Windows 7, required Microsoft updates include KB4490628 and KB4474419 for successful installation.
